summaryrefslogtreecommitdiff
path: root/audio/taglib
diff options
context:
space:
mode:
authorwiz <wiz@pkgsrc.org>2015-11-17 10:43:42 +0000
committerwiz <wiz@pkgsrc.org>2015-11-17 10:43:42 +0000
commite37ab6ad4cc6035d0be299135c8b23f480913762 (patch)
treebc360d77a9e0edde2d40d9b7e49fdad5fb2cbefb /audio/taglib
parent12073fd84920ef928f1e7e0300b7f8a77c070cf5 (diff)
downloadpkgsrc-e37ab6ad4cc6035d0be299135c8b23f480913762.tar.gz
Update taglib to 1.10:
TagLib 1.10 (Nov 11, 2015) ========================== 1.10: * Added new options to the tagwriter example. * Fixed self-assignment operator in some types. * Fixed extraction of MP4 tag keys with an empty list. 1.10 BETA: * New API for the audio length in milliseconds. * Added support for ID3v2 ETCO and SYLT frames. * Added support for album artist in PropertyMap API of MP4 files. * Added support for embedded frames in ID3v2 CHAP and CTOC frames. * Added support for AIFF-C files. * Better handling of duplicate ID3v2 tags in MPEG files. * Allowed generating taglib.pc on Windows. * Added ZLIB_SOURCE build option. * Fixed backwards-incompatible change in TagLib::String when constructing UTF16 strings. * Fixed crash when parsing certain FLAC files. * Fixed crash when encoding empty strings. * Fixed saving of certain XM files on OS X. * Changed Xiph and APE generic getters to return space-concatenated values. * Fixed possible file corruptions when removing tags from WAV files. * Added support for MP4 files with 64-bit atoms in certain 64-bit environments. * Prevented ID3v2 padding from being too large. * Fixed crash when parsing corrupted APE files. * Fixed crash when parsing corrupted WAV files. * Fixed crash when parsing corrupted Ogg FLAC files. * Fixed crash when parsing corrupted MPEG files. * Fixed saving empty tags in WAV files. * Fixed crash when parsing corrupted Musepack files. * Fixed possible memory leaks when parsing AIFF and WAV files. * Fixed crash when parsing corrupted MP4 files. * Stopped writing empty ID3v2 frames. * Fixed possible file corruptions when saving WMA files. * Added TagLib::MP4::Tag::isEmpty(). * Added accessors to manipulate MP4 tags. * Fixed crash when parsing corrupted WavPack files. * Fixed seeking MPEG frames. * Fixed reading FLAC files with zero-sized padding blocks. * Added support for reading the encoder information of WMA files. * Added support for reading the codec of WAV files. * Added support for multi channel WavPack files. * Added support for reading the nominal bitrate of Ogg Speex files. * Added support for VBR headers in MPEG files. * Marked FLAC::File::streamInfoData() deprecated. It returns an empty ByteVector. * Marked FLAC::File::streamLength() deprecated. It returns zero. * Fixed possible file corruptions when adding an ID3v1 tag to FLAC files. * Many smaller bug fixes and performance improvements.
Diffstat (limited to 'audio/taglib')
-rw-r--r--audio/taglib/Makefile4
-rw-r--r--audio/taglib/PLIST8
-rw-r--r--audio/taglib/distinfo10
3 files changed, 13 insertions, 9 deletions
diff --git a/audio/taglib/Makefile b/audio/taglib/Makefile
index 7938398d336..3b9c25dbe2f 100644
--- a/audio/taglib/Makefile
+++ b/audio/taglib/Makefile
@@ -1,6 +1,6 @@
-# $NetBSD: Makefile,v 1.33 2013/10/24 06:08:44 obache Exp $
+# $NetBSD: Makefile,v 1.34 2015/11/17 10:43:42 wiz Exp $
-DISTNAME= taglib-1.9.1
+DISTNAME= taglib-1.10
CATEGORIES= audio
MASTER_SITES= http://taglib.github.io/releases/
diff --git a/audio/taglib/PLIST b/audio/taglib/PLIST
index 106e00475aa..952e34621d6 100644
--- a/audio/taglib/PLIST
+++ b/audio/taglib/PLIST
@@ -1,4 +1,4 @@
-@comment $NetBSD: PLIST,v 1.16 2013/10/17 07:30:39 wiz Exp $
+@comment $NetBSD: PLIST,v 1.17 2015/11/17 10:43:42 wiz Exp $
bin/taglib-config
include/taglib/aifffile.h
include/taglib/aiffproperties.h
@@ -14,7 +14,9 @@ include/taglib/asfproperties.h
include/taglib/asftag.h
include/taglib/attachedpictureframe.h
include/taglib/audioproperties.h
+include/taglib/chapterframe.h
include/taglib/commentsframe.h
+include/taglib/eventtimingcodesframe.h
include/taglib/fileref.h
include/taglib/flacfile.h
include/taglib/flacmetadatablock.h
@@ -63,6 +65,8 @@ include/taglib/s3mfile.h
include/taglib/s3mproperties.h
include/taglib/speexfile.h
include/taglib/speexproperties.h
+include/taglib/synchronizedlyricsframe.h
+include/taglib/tableofcontentsframe.h
include/taglib/tag.h
include/taglib/tag_c.h
include/taglib/taglib.h
@@ -102,7 +106,7 @@ include/taglib/xmfile.h
include/taglib/xmproperties.h
lib/libtag.so
lib/libtag.so.1
-lib/libtag.so.1.14.0
+lib/libtag.so.1.15.1
lib/libtag_c.so
lib/libtag_c.so.0
lib/libtag_c.so.0.0.0
diff --git a/audio/taglib/distinfo b/audio/taglib/distinfo
index bcfd3e4c83c..a52dff6ecdb 100644
--- a/audio/taglib/distinfo
+++ b/audio/taglib/distinfo
@@ -1,6 +1,6 @@
-$NetBSD: distinfo,v 1.18 2015/11/03 01:12:52 agc Exp $
+$NetBSD: distinfo,v 1.19 2015/11/17 10:43:42 wiz Exp $
-SHA1 (taglib-1.9.1.tar.gz) = 4fa426c453297e62c1d1eff64a46e76ed8bebb45
-RMD160 (taglib-1.9.1.tar.gz) = 932a71f5c9e8fe332a90d29a36ac1310c025879c
-SHA512 (taglib-1.9.1.tar.gz) = 63a4f06b88b33be716dde3111e62a624995bc020127c9d22f63e918a535ebba858c59308ca4295eeedb29dc72b87d6673db5483f20d9dbf3f56cd93c7ba7ed58
-Size (taglib-1.9.1.tar.gz) = 654074 bytes
+SHA1 (taglib-1.10.tar.gz) = 9da145f9845978b4a281ad61987475486d24152a
+RMD160 (taglib-1.10.tar.gz) = a02682defc8f6a611e28e5e8db6dd72310a18230
+SHA512 (taglib-1.10.tar.gz) = 2257918743507fffae01b961c714aa8523d3a8c0c921af699b0160c2414b1c930778f19976965e3197571672120a6040dbb13a83304b70290970660abcf27820
+Size (taglib-1.10.tar.gz) = 1233893 bytes